Overview
- BUND Berlin urges the Senate to retain Tempo 30 zones wherever possible, citing environmental and public health benefits.
- The Senate is considering removing all-day Tempo 30 restrictions on 34 main thoroughfares after recent improvements in air quality.
- Traffic Senator Ute Bonde plans to enforce Tempo 30 at night from 22:00 to 06:00 on multiple streets to reduce noise pollution.
- The BUND warns that lifting speed limits now could conflict with upcoming EU air quality standards for 2030 and prompt reimposition.
- A final decision on a new air quality plan and the future of main road speed limits is expected in early August.
